Amalia Parvis
Amalia (Ami) comes to the Meadows Mental Health Policy Institute with nearly ten years of experience supporting human resources, faculty affairs, and administrative operations in higher education and academic health environments. Much of her career was spent at the University of Miami, where she supported both the Office of Faculty Affairs (Academy) and the School of Medicine, helping welcome new faculty and staff through onboarding coordination, HR systems support, and training facilitation. Prior to joining the Meadows Institute, Amalia served as a senior support assistant at The University of Texas Health Science Center at Houston School of Dentistry, supporting day-to-day operations through scheduling, documentation, data tracking, and cross-team coordination. She has also held HR roles in academic medicine, including serving as Human Resources Manager within the Herbert Wertheim College of Medicine at Florida International University.
In her Meadows Institute role, Amalia supports the work of the Vice President of Human Resources and the Senior Vice President of Operations by assisting with onboarding and offboarding coordination, employee support and staff-facing communications, benefits and employee resource support, asset and equipment tracking, and a variety of Meadows Institute-wide administrative and operational initiatives.
Amalia holds a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ources Management from the University of Miami and is fully bilingual in English and Spanish. She is based in Houston, Texas. Outside of work, she is an avid freediver and volunteers with the Refugee Assistance Alliance, supporting newcomers through community-based service and advocacy.
